After seeing an interview with Scott, London and a friend of London's, at appears that the bag-checking wasn't what got B&S to the speedway first - it was a faster cab. Scott said their cab driver was really fast and went 120 on the highway. London said their cab driver was slow as molasses and even worse on the way back. So a lot of it did come down to "bad taxi luck."

On the other hand, it appears that B&S were the only team to cram and study Chicago, specifically, on their way back from Korea. They  wrote copious notes about Chicago landmarks - and already had the address written down for 2 of the 3 locations they needed to find in the postcard task. Neither of the other two teams planned out a route, either, and London says she and Logan went to the wrong location for one of them just like Tara and Joey did.

Other tidbits: Scott said Brooke did let him carry her piggy-back for about a block. And London says Joey actually helped her with the tire at the speed track while Tara was doing laps.
